Transaction 3c91a2b19cdbab43eb82de15f2f2218fca71fee11c91d4e52096624c94a63a71

1 Input
2 Outputs
  • 3c91a2b19cdbab43eb82de15f2f2218fca71fee11c91d4e52096624c94a63a71:0
  • value  500000
    address  1HnV6DFvhGhywapbMiUFBrUEfWRhGq8TSn
  • 3c91a2b19cdbab43eb82de15f2f2218fca71fee11c91d4e52096624c94a63a71:1
  • value  2472880
    address  14RF5UYmXUfYmu8nbdkyFN2vT66wUo4B3x